Marks and reviews

93

/100

Decanter

Medium gold in colour. Rich yellow-fruit notes, a floral lift, and a dense, spiced palate. Quince, pineapple and ripe apple with a sweet-fruited finish.

93

/100

Jeff Leve

Leve Jeff

Honeysuckle, pears, green apples, white peaches, and citrus notes shine on the nose and palate. The wine is crisp and juicy, delivering its blend of green apples and zesty citrus fruits with ease, finishing with bright lemons and crushed-stone minerality that carries through the backend. This will be a pleasure to drink on release. The wine blends 70% Sauvignon Blanc with 30% Semillon. 12.5% ABV. Drink from 2027–2033. 93–93 pts

96

/100

Yves Beck

Depth paired with intensity, freshness and subtlety: that’s Fieuzal in aromatic terms. Everything is coherent, with a Sauvignon Blanc that is certainly persistent but hardly dominant, a present oak influence that does what it needs to do—showcasing the other elements of the bouquet—and then an open, almost Sauternes-like touch embodied by the Sémillon! On the palate, the wine stays true to this idea of balance, or fusion. It has breadth, a touch of charm, and then an incisive, saline structure in step with an energising austerity. The result is a stratospheric Fieuzal that will delight palates receptive to the authenticity and freshness of a Pessac Léognan!

94

/100

Jane Anson

Jane Anson

Medium intensity pale gold colour, beautiful grip and lift on the attack, gentle wash of cloves and gunsmoke, this is super pretty, well placed with lift and pared back white peach and nectarine flesh. A gourmet style of white in the vintage, great quality from estate director Stephen Carrier.

92

/100

Jean-Marc Quarin

Jean-Marc Quarin

Pale yellow colour. The nose is intense, refined, fruity and smooth. Delicate on the attack, then very flavoursome, with a hint of mandarin and white-fleshed fruit, the wine glides across the palate through to a subtle, lingering finish. Blend: 70% Sauvignon Blanc, 30% Sémillon. Alcohol content: 12.5%.
